Analysis

Kenya recorded 0.0011 TDS, current US$ per US$ of GDP for imf repurchases and charges (tds, current us$), per unit of gdp in 2024.

That represents a change of up 0.1% on the previous year and up 27.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, imf repurchases and charges (tds, current us$), per unit of gdp in Kenya peaked at 0.0216 TDS, current US$ per US$ of GDP in 1986 and was at its lowest, 0.0003 TDS, current US$ per US$ of GDP, in 2008.

That places Kenya 74th out of 122 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

IMF repurchases and charges (TDS, current US$)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

IMF repurchases and charges (TDS, current US$) ÷ GDP (current US$)
